Guruprasad won't work with Sudeep, Darshan, Uppi

By By: Shekhar H Hooli

Mata fame director Guruprasad, whose movie Eddelu Manjunatha is doing very well at the Box Office, has said that he does not want to work with super stars like Sudeep, Darshan and Upendra. He would like to direct comedy actors like Jaggesh, Komal Kumar, Rangayan Raghu and Tabala Nani.

In a recent interview to Oneindia.in, the director said that he would like to make creative movies with small budget. He criticised the producers, who are spoiling the quality of the Kannada films for money. He warned such produces, "if they would not correct themselves soon, Kannada film industry would sure to land at trouble."

Guruprasad denied the reports of the clash between him and Jaggesh. He said, "I don't have any clash with Jaggesh. Of course, I and producer Sanathkumar had some idealogical clashes, which have been solved now. In fact, the chemistry between me and Jaggesh works out very well. That's why both the movies Mata and Eddelu Manjunatha are successful at the Box Office."

However, director Guruprasad has got offers from 14 producers after the success of the movie Eddelu Manjunatha. "I will accept the offer of the producers those love creative movies and pay me higher amount of money," Guruprasad said.
